Cost-Effectiveness: Comparing the Monetary Elements of Oral Implants and Dentures



If you're considering dental implants or dentures, you might be questioning which choice is extra affordable. When it involves cost, it's important to think about both the first investment and the long-term costs.

Dental implants often tend to have a higher in advance price contrasted to dentures. emergency dental no insurance no money is due to the fact that the procedure of dental implant placement involves surgical procedure and making use of top notch materials. Nonetheless, surgery dental implants keeping in mind that dental implants are designed to be a long-term service. They're extra sturdy and can last a lifetime with proper treatment, lowering the demand for frequent replacements or fixings.

On the other hand, dentures may have a lower first expense, yet they may require modifications, relining, and even substitute in time, which can accumulate in terms of recurring expenditures.

Ultimately, the cost-effectiveness of oral implants versus dentures depends upon your specific needs and choices, along with your lasting dental health goals.

1. Implants: Oral implants are developed to be a long-term option for missing out on teeth. With appropriate care and upkeep, they can last a lifetime. This is since implants are surgically put in the jawbone, giving a steady foundation for synthetic teeth.

2. Dentures: Dentures, on the other hand, are removable devices that replace missing out on teeth. While they can be a cost-effective option, they typically have a shorter life expectancy contrasted to implants. Dentures may need to be changed every 5-7 years as a result of damage.

3. Maintenance: Dental implants call for normal cleaning, flossing, and dental examinations, similar to natural teeth. Dentures require day-to-day cleaning and soaking to avoid bacteria buildup.

4. Bone Health: Dental implants promote the jawbone, preventing bone loss and protecting facial framework. Dentures, however, do not give the very same level of stimulation, which can bring about bone loss with time.

Oral Health Conveniences: Examining the Influence of Oral Implants and Dentures on General Oral Health



Keeping correct dental hygiene is essential in evaluating the effect of oral implants and dentures on your general dental health and wellness.



Dental implants supply substantial dental wellness advantages as they operate like natural teeth, boosting the jawbone and stopping bone loss. This aids in keeping the structure and integrity of your jaw, which subsequently supports your face attributes.

With oral implants, you can appreciate an extra all-natural biting and eating experience, enabling you to consume a broader series of foods easily. In addition, oral implants do not require any type of special cleansing methods; you can simply comb and floss them like your natural teeth.

On the other hand, dentures need special treatment and cleaning, as they require to be gotten rid of and cleaned independently. Dentures can additionally cause periodontal inflammation and discomfort otherwise properly fitted.
